Inclusion Criteria

Aged 20 to 70 years old; Absence of trouble hearing; Absence of psychiatric illness recognized; Not use sedative or anti-anxiety drugs except of the routine method; Not having with substance abuse; Unfamiliarity with the same periods with Benson’s relaxation in the experimental and control groups; Absence of musculoskeletal system disorder; The ability to communicate in Persian language; The ability to taking Benson’s relaxation training; Absence of contraindications to control blood pressure and pulse of the right hand.
Exclusion criteria:? Unwillingness to continue cooperation in the study at any time of the study.
